The Power And Potential Of Biopharma Systems

In the world of healthcare and biotechnology, the development of innovative therapies and treatments relies heavily on cutting-edge technology and sophisticated systems. biopharma systems play a crucial role in the research, development, and production of biopharmaceuticals, which are a class of drugs derived from living organisms. These systems are essential for delivering safe, effective, and high-quality medications to patients around the world.

biopharma systems encompass a wide array of technologies, including bioreactors, purification systems, analytical instruments, and automation platforms. These systems are designed to streamline the processes involved in producing biopharmaceuticals, from cell culture and fermentation to purification and formulation. By utilizing these advanced technologies, biopharmaceutical companies can enhance productivity, reduce costs, and improve the overall quality of their products.

One of the key components of biopharma systems is the bioreactor, which serves as a controlled environment for cell culture and fermentation. Bioreactors come in various sizes and designs, ranging from small benchtop systems to large-scale production units. These systems provide optimal conditions for the growth and expression of cells, enabling the production of therapeutic proteins, antibodies, and other biopharmaceuticals.

Purification systems are another essential element of biopharma systems, as they are responsible for isolating and purifying the desired product from the complex mixture of substances generated during the production process. These systems employ various techniques, such as chromatography, filtration, and ultrafiltration, to separate and purify the target molecule with high efficiency and purity.

Analytical instruments are also critical components of biopharma systems, as they enable researchers and manufacturers to analyze and characterize the properties of biopharmaceutical products. These instruments can assess the purity, potency, and stability of the final product, ensuring that it meets the necessary quality standards and regulatory requirements. By utilizing advanced analytical tools, biopharmaceutical companies can achieve greater control over the production process and optimize the performance of their products.

Automation platforms play a vital role in modern biopharma systems, as they enable the integration and orchestration of various processes to enhance efficiency and consistency. These platforms utilize robotics, sensors, and software algorithms to automate tasks such as cell culture maintenance, media preparation, and sample analysis. By implementing automation, biopharmaceutical companies can accelerate their production timelines, reduce the risk of errors, and increase the scalability of their operations.
